The paging navigation could be improved. Now we have:
Page: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 15 Previous 15 Next 15
Most "pagers" I've used present Prev and Next links and shift the central 10 or so pages all the time, so you get something like:
Prev 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 Next
I'm used to press Next to get to the next page, and end up pressing on 'Next 15'
in any case 'prev' is usually expected on the left side, if 'next' is on the right :)
